A walk-up apartment in Collegeville, PA had a kitchen stack clog every holiday. We scoped, found grease and rice buildup, jetted the stack, and set pre-holiday maintenance. Zero backups since.
A boutique cafes floor drain overflowed during brunch. We staged mats, cleared the main, sanitized floors, and set a monthly grease-management plan. The cafe stayed open with no lost revenue.
Boards appreciate visuals and concise next steps.
Staff coaching plus the right enzymes keeps lines open.
A brownstone with aging cast iron saw black sludge backups. We tuned jetting pressure, descaled carefully, and mapped the line for future planning. The owner deferred costly replacement while keeping drains clear.
A retail space had sewer odor near the entrance. We traced a dry trap and a loose cleanout cap, sealed both, and added a maintenance reminder. Odor vanished before the weekend foot traffic.
An HOA requested proof before approving stack jetting. We captured video, shared findings, and outlined phased work by riser. Approval came in one meeting.
A gyms locker room drains slowed nightly. We scheduled post-close jetting, sanitized floors, and applied enzymes. Members returned to fresh, fast drains each morning.
City maintenance playbook
Maintenance is strategy, not guesswork. The right cadence keeps residents comfortable and businesses open.
Air bubbles, echoing drains, and damp grout lines hint at venting or partial blockagesaddress them early.
Housekeeping habits: never pour fats or coffee grounds, use strainers in every sink and shower, and run hot water after soapy loads. For buildings, post simple drain rules in utility rooms to guide tenants.
